Diamond clarity classification:

Inclusions in diamonds refer to impurities, including clouds and cracks. The less inclusions, the higher the clarity grade, the rarer the diamond and the higher its value.

FL: Flawless-when viewed by professionals under the magnification of 10, there are no flaws inside and outside, which is the rarest and most precious among all cleanliness grades.

If: flawless interior-professionals observe under the magnification of 10, there are no flaws inside, but there are tiny flaws on the diamond surface.

VVS 1: Very tiny flaw1-At the magnification of 10, professionals only observed a tiny flaw.

Vvs 2:2: Very tiny defects-professionals observed individual tiny defects under the magnification of 10 times.

VS 1: micro-flaw 1- 10 times magnification, it is difficult to single micro-flaw.

VS2: Micro-defect level 2- 10 times magnification is more difficult to count micro-defects.

SI 1: small defects 1 level-10 times magnification, obvious defects are easy to observe.

SI2: Small defect level 2- 10 times magnification, it is easy to observe several obvious defects.

P 1 (floret): Generally, it is between visible and invisible when viewed from the crown with naked eyes. It's easy to see the flaws.

P2 (middle flower): The naked eye can easily see larger or more inclusions from the crown, which has obvious influence on the brightness of the diamond and makes it look dull. It will also affect the durability of diamonds.

P3 (Big Flower): It is easy to see the characteristics of diamonds with naked eyes, and the number or individuals are very large. They not only affect the transparency and brightness of diamonds, but also affect the durability of diamonds. Typical transparency features are large plumes of smoke, a group of cracks or large cracks. P3 diamonds are almost the same as industrial diamonds.

Carat weight

The weight of diamonds is measured in carats (also called cards). 1 carat = 200mg = 0.2g A carat is divided into one hundred parts, and each part is called one point. 0.75 carat is also called 75 minutes, and 0.0 1 carat is 1 minute. Under other similar conditions, with the increase of diamond weight, its value increases geometrically; Diamonds with the same weight will have different values due to different colors, cleanliness and cutting. Clarity (clarity)

Diamonds are crystallized from mantle magma deep in the earth, with complex environment, diverse components and extremely high temperature and pressure. After hundreds of millions of years of geological changes, it is inevitable that there are all kinds of sundries or defects in it. The color, quantity, size and location distribution of these inclusions have different degrees of influence on the clarity of diamonds.

The clarity of a diamond is usually classified by using a magnifying glass with a magnification of 10 to classify the internal and surface defects of the diamond and their influence on the luster. According to China's national inspection standards, it is divided into LC, VVS 1, VVS2, VS 1, VS2, SI 1, SI2, P 1 and P2. Diamonds are divided into five grades: excellent, very good, good and relatively good. P-class drill is also called I-class drill. Diamonds below grade P are generally not used as gem diamonds, so they are generally only classified as grade P and are no longer classified as P1; P2; P3 .

Color (color)

Diamonds have many natural colors, from precious colorless (white after cutting), rare light blue and pink to common light yellow. The more transparent and colorless, the more white can penetrate, and the richer the color after refraction and dispersion.

The grading of diamond color is determined by technicians repeatedly comparing the diamond to be graded with the standard color colorimetric stone in the grading environment of professional laboratories.

The whitest diamond is set to D (that is, starting from the first letter of the diamond). The color of diamonds is divided into 1 1 grades, which are D, E, F, G, H, I, J, K, L, M and N in turn.

Cut (cut)

Diamond cutting refers to the accuracy of its cutting and grinding ratio and the perfection after finishing. Good cutting should reflect the brightness and fire color of the diamond as much as possible, and try to keep the weight of the original stone. The cutting grades of IGI International Gemological Institute are divided into ID (standard), EX (excellent) and VG (very good) G (good) from high to low, and the domestic national inspection is divided into VG (very good) and G (good).

What colors do diamonds have? Which is the best?

Among the colorless diamonds, there is also a kind of crystal clear and water-transparent diamond, which can feel a pure light blue with the naked eye. This kind of diamond is called "fire and water diamond" and it is also the best among colorless diamonds.

Most natural diamonds contain different kinds of pigments. Generally speaking, pigments have a great influence on evaluating the quality of colorless diamonds, such as impure blue or yellow, brown, etc., which are all important factors to degrade colorless diamonds. However, when a diamond has pure and obvious color, it does not belong to the category of "colorless diamond", especially when it has red, dark blue, pink, rose red, golden yellow, green and other colors, it belongs to a rare colored diamond. Colored diamonds known a few days ago can be divided into the following categories according to their colors:

First, red diamonds: red diamonds are divided into blood diamonds and purple diamonds according to color. Blood diamonds are as bright as blood, gorgeous and incomparable, which are extremely precious and rare in colored diamond. 1989 In the spring, a 2.23-carat blood diamond named "Laqi" was exhibited at a jewelry fair in Paris, with a bid of $42 million. The beauty of "Laqi" is fascinating, and its expensive price is staggering. Compared with the price of gold at that time, it was more than100000 times of gold and more than 2000 times more expensive than colorless diamonds. "Laqi" blood diamond originated in Gorgonda, an ancient Indian diamond mining area, which means "great wealth". Judging from its mass production, it has a history of nearly 500 years.

1April, 987, one weighing 0. 95 carats were sold at a jewelry auction in the United States for $880,000, and other expenses were nearly $950,000, which set a record for purple diamonds per carat/kloc-0.0 million dollars. It is understood that several blood diamonds have been found in the world, and one of them is still kept in the Smithsonian Museum. The whereabouts of the rest are unknown.

2. pink diamond: It is a light pink or rose diamond with elegant and quiet color and elegant and luxurious charm. 1980, a pink diamond weighing 2.27 carats was sold at a price of127,000 USD. 1June, 990, a pink diamond originally belonging to the Mughal Emperor of the North Indian Empire was auctioned at Christie's auction house in London, England. This diamond weighs 32.24 carats, and the auction price is 4.07 million pounds, with an average of $220,000 per carat. It is reported that Iranian King Pahlavi wore a Wang Guanzhong inlaid with a giant pink diamond, weighing about 60 carats, at his wedding in 1958. According to research, pink diamond was originally named "Sea of Light" and weighed 787 carats. It was produced in17th century in the famous Colell diamond mine in Golconda region of ancient India. The maharaja of Mimomora, who originally belonged to ancient India, was later accepted as a tribute of Mughal emperor Shajehan. After the first polishing by Indian craftsmen, it became a rose-shaped diamond ornament weighing only 300 carats. 1739, King Nadir of Persia led his troops into Delhi, the Mughal capital, and the "Sea of Light" became the trophy of the Persian kingdom and was brought back to Tehran. After several polishing, only 60 carats of modern batch diamond ornaments were left, which were renamed "Eye of Light" and embedded in the crown worn by the Iranian king at his wedding.

In pink diamond, the diamond mine in argyle produces a certain amount of pink diamond and rose diamonds. Generally, the particle size is not large, and the average price of a carat diamond is 1000 USD, of which the sales price of a 3 is. The 5-carat rose diamond is as high as $3.5 million.

Third, green diamonds: the green tones in diamonds are different, and the depth of green in a green diamond is often different. Generally speaking, a uniform green color is better, and a simple and elegant color tone is better. The most famous green diamond in the world is the "Dresden" green diamond discovered in 1743, weighing 408 carats, even apple green. At that time, it was worth 3 million pounds, and now the lowest valuation is 10 million dollars. Dark green diamond particles have been found many times in the diamond deposit in Tancheng, Shandong Province.

4. Yellow diamond: Yellow diamond, also known as golden diamond, refers to the yellow or golden diamond with pure color and bright tone. Besides yellow and golden yellow, wine yellow and amber diamonds are also common. Such as "Taifini" yellow diamond and "Tibeia" gold diamond (the diamond weighs 234.5 carats), and "Golden Rooster Diamond" produced in Tancheng, Shandong, China, weighs 28 1. 25 carats. This diamond is apricot yellow, gorgeous and captures sunlight. This is the largest gold diamond found in the world. 1938 was snatched by the Japanese invaders, and its whereabouts are still unknown.

What are the grades of clarity of diamonds?

Diamonds are classified according to the position, size and quantity of inclusions. From high to low, it can be divided into FL, IF, VVS 1, VVS 2, VS 1, VS 2, Si 1, Si2, Si3, P 1, P2, P3. Observe them carefully under a ten-fold microscope.

1, fl-"perfect", perfect. Under the magnifying glass of ten times, there are no flaws inside and outside.

2. If-"there is no flaw inside", there is no flaw inside. Under the magnifying glass of ten times, only the surface has slight flower marks.

3.vvs 1, vvs2-"very very narrow", very, very small. Defects that are hard to see under a ten-fold magnifying glass. The definition of VVS 1 is higher than that of VVS2.

4. VS 1 and vs2-"very thin", very small. Defects can be seen under a magnifying glass of ten times, but it is difficult for the naked eye to recognize them. The definition of VS 1 is higher than that of VS2.

5, Si 1 and si2-"light inclusions", small flaws, which may be visible to the naked eye.

6.I 1, I2, i3-"Imperfect" is flawed and visible to the naked eye.
